Who funds Lynnwood Food Bank?

Lynnwood Food Bank is funded by 18 grantmakers, led by Network for Good ($239K), Hubbard Family Foundation ($58K), The Independent Charitable Gift Fund ($50K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$560K in grants to Lynnwood Food Bank between 2020–2025.

Who is Lynnwood Food Bank's largest funder?

Network for Good is the largest recorded funder of Lynnwood Food Bank, with $239K across 5 grants (2020–2024).

How much grant funding has Lynnwood Food Bank received?

IRS 990 filings record $560K in grants to Lynnwood Food Bank across 38 grants from 18 funders between 2020–2025. Filings are published on a delay, so recent grants may not appear yet.
